Transaction d52e4a353e7f781ab3423db6405836ae5e96ec736b540abff6d66c338fc23f6b
1 Input
1 Output
-
d52e4a353e7f781ab3423db6405836ae5e96ec736b540abff6d66c338fc23f6b:0
- value
- 2996388
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c2a69e300a6b5d181f8c9a2ab7afc61d25d09574 OP_EQUAL
- address
- 3KSEcaJKMRNLUymjX8Qct7NUKu136gLxVo